Economic Empowerment of Women Entrepreneurs – A Study of Districts of North Karnataka (Part of UGC supported major research project) Dr. Shiralashetti A.S. Assistant Professor, Department of Studies in Commerce, Karnatak University, Dharwad-03 Online published on 4 September, 2013. Abstract Women entrepreneurship has gained momentum in recent decades due to increase in the number of women's enterprises and their substantive contribution to economic growth. In this dynamic world, women entrepreneurs are an important part of the global quest for sustained economic development and social progress. Economic empowerment increases women's access to economic resources and opportunities including jobs, financial services, property and other productive assets, skills development and market information. Empowering women entrepreneurs is essential for achieving the goals of sustainable development and the bottlenecks hindering their growth must be eradicated to enable full participation in business. The present study concentrates on economic empowerment of women entrepreneurs. Top Keywords Decision Making, Empowerment, Economic-Empower, Personality Elements, Public Utilities. Top | |
